US Space Force is Global Catalyst for Transformation of Space Into ‘An Arena of War’

The Boeing CTS-100 Starliner’s maiden mission may have been a failure in multiple areas, but that did not stop NASA from putting a congratulatory spin on the costly endeavor and, according to two experts, will not dull Washington’s enthusiasm to pour more tax dollars into the militarization of space.

Prof. Karl Grossman, a professor of journalism at the State University of New York, College at Old Westbury; and Bruce Gagnon, coordinator of the Global Network Against Weapons & Nuclear Power in Space, joined Radio Sputnik’s Loud and Clear on Thursday to give their thoughts on the Starliner’s botched voyage and how it parallels to the US’ long-term goal of militarizing space.

“Starliner hit the bullseye. It landed exactly where it was supposed to,” a NASA commentator said during a broadcast following the spacecraft’s full return to Earth. 

Despite NASA and Boeing’s shared enthusiasm, in reality, the spacecraft completely failed its primary mission: docking with the International Space Station. 

Grossman explained that while accidents do indeed happen, “in terms of rocket launches, one out of a hundred fail catastrophically,” and the issue is not always necessarily mechanical. 

Even with this 1 in 100 failure rate and the potential for a catastrophic event, “there’s this big push to build nuclear-powered rockets for quicker trips to Mars,” Grossman said. 

Gagnon argued that between the failures of missions such as the Starliner’s and the formation of the United States’ Space Force, the US’ sixth military branch, through the recent signing of the 2020 National Defence Authorization Act, “they have to pretend that everything is OK with these space technology operations.” 

“The relevant US actions are a serious violation of the international consensus on the peaceful use of outer space, undermine global strategic balance and stability, and pose a direct threat to outer space peace and security,” Chinese Foreign Ministry spokesman Geng Shuang told reporters on Monday. 

“Russia has always been and will remain opposed to the military use of space,” Russian President Vladimir Putin said earlier this month. “Leading nations of the world are actively developing modern space systems for military use … and the United States, in particular, is openly regarding space as a war theatre.”

Nevertheless, Washington maintains that it must continue to “maintain American dominance” on every front.

“The US is pushing the world, headlong, into making space an arena of war, and other countries will not stand for it,” Grossman contended.
